Sans Normal Feny 10 is a very light, normal width, low cont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A delicate monoline sans with near-uniform stroke weight and a clean geometric backbone. Curves are smooth and circular, while straight strokes remain crisp, producing a calm, even rhythm across the alphabet. Proportions feel balanced and contemporary, with open apertures and generous interior counters that keep forms from clogging despite the slender outlines. Numerals match the same light, linear construction and roundness, maintaining consistency in mixed text.
Best suited to headlines, logotypes, brand systems, and editorial display where its fine strokes and open geometry can be appreciated. It also works well for premium packaging and large-format signage or posters, especially in high-contrast print or screen contexts where thin lines remain clear.
The overall tone is quiet and sophisticated, with a restrained, design-forward character. Its thin strokes and spacious forms create an airy, premium feel that reads as modern and understated rather than expressive or playful.
The font appears designed to deliver a minimal, contemporary sans voice with an emphasis on lightness and clarity. Its consistent monoline construction and geometric curves suggest an intention to look refined and modern while staying neutral enough for a wide range of design systems.
The design relies on outline-like thin strokes and careful spacing, which emphasizes whiteness and negative space in both display lines and larger text settings. Round letters (O/C/G/Q) and simple, straight-sided structures (E/F/H/I/L/T) share a consistent visual logic, giving the font a cohesive, polished presence.
